ABSTRACT
This study examines the effect of critical life event and school climate on turnover intentions of secondary school teachers. A descriptive survey research design was adopted for this study. The sample for this study comprised secondary school teachers in Ijebu-north local government of Ogun State, which are selected through random sampling technique. The data was collected using three instruments titled “Impact of Life Event Scale”, “School Climate Survey” and “Turnover Intention Scale”. Multiple regression analysis and Pearson Moment Correlation Coefficient were used to analyse the three hypotheses formulated in the study. The result revealed that there is significant relationship between critical life event and turnover intentions of secondary school teachers. It showed that there is significant relationship between school climate and turnover intentions of secondary school teachers. Also critical life event and school climate have composite effect on turnover intentions of secondary school teachers. Based on the findings of the study, government and policy maker need to take seriously their share of responsibility in protecting the lives and properties of the teachers, and also need to see to motivating and providing necessary facilities for teachers in order to make them happy at all time and get committed to their job
